Question - Wong purchased a computer for $15,000, net of GST. Originally it had an estimated useful life of 4 years and a residual value of $3,000. The straight-line method is used. At the start of the third year of usage, Wong revised the life to a total life of 6 years with the same residual value of $3,000. What depreciation expense should be recorded for the computer for year 3?

a. $3,000.

b. $1,000.

c. $4,000.

d. $1,500.
